ataribaby Posted February 25, 2021 Author Share Posted February 25, 2021 (edited) Did you modified your DCS MissionScripting.lua per readme.txt please? To enable campaign persistence, comment out following lines in the file \scripts\MissionScripting.lua inside your DCS game/DCS server install. --sanitizeModule('os' ) --sanitizeModule('io' ) --sanitizeModule('lfs' ) --require = nil It is only reason I can think of why campaign doesn't work. Please show me your MissionScripting.lua and dcs.log maybe there is some other problem. Also where did you placed missons? They must be in Missions folder root. ataribaby Posted April 27, 2021 Author Share Posted April 27, 2021 Of course you can access them. I am just using Total Commander to double click on miz file and you will open it as folder - miz is in reality ordinary zip file then you can extract, edit replace oob.lua Scipts are in l10n\DEFAULT\ folder inside miz file.
